# @flipflop-sdk/node A comprehensive Node.js SDK for FlipFlop token operations on Solana. This library provides programmatic access to token launches, Universal Referral Code (URC) management, batch minting operations, and metadata management. ## Installation ```bash npm install @flipflop-sdk/node # or yarn add @flipflop-sdk/node ``` ## Quick Start ### Basic Usage ```javascript const { launchToken, mintToken, setUrc, getMintData, getUrcData, getSystemConfig, generateMetadataUri, validateImageFile } = require('@flipflop-sdk/node'); async function example() { // Generate metadata URI first const metadataResult = await generateMetadataUri({ rpc: 'https://api.devnet.solana.com', name: 'My Token', symbol: 'MTK', description: 'A sample token for demonstration', imagePath: './path/to/token-logo.png' }); if (metadataResult.success) { console.log('Metadata URI:', metadataResult.metadataUrl); console.log('Image URI:', metadataResult.imageUrl); } // Launch a new token with metadata const launchResult = await launchToken({ rpc: 'https://api.devnet.solana.com', name: 'My Token', symbol: 'MTK', tokenType: 'meme', // or 'standard' uri: metadataResult.metadataUrl, // Use generated metadata URI keypairBs58: 'your-base58-private-key' }); console.log('Token launched:', launchResult.mintAddress.toString()); console.log('Transaction:', launchResult.transactionHash); // Set URC code const urcResult = await setUrc({ rpc: 'https://api.devnet.solana.com', mint: launchResult.mintAddress.toString(), urc: 'MYCODE2024', keypairBs58: 'your-base58-private-key' }); console.log('URC set:', urcResult.urc); console.log('Usage count:', urcResult.usageCount); // Mint tokens const mintResult = await mintToken({ rpc: 'https://api.devnet.solana.com', mint: launchResult.mintAddress.toString(), urc: 'MYCODE2024', keypairBs58: 'minter-base58-private-key' }); if (mintResult.success) { console.log('Mint successful:', mintResult.data?.tx); console.log('Token account:', mintResult.data?.tokenAccount.toString()); } // Get token information const tokenInfo = await getMintData({ rpc: 'https://api.devnet.solana.com', mint: launchResult.mintAddress.toString() }); console.log('Token name:', tokenInfo.name); console.log('Token symbol:', tokenInfo.symbol); console.log('Current supply:', tokenInfo.currentSupply); console.log('Max supply:', tokenInfo.maxSupply); // Get URC information const urcInfo = await getUrcData({ rpc: 'https://api.devnet.solana.com', urc: 'MYCODE2024' }); console.log('URC valid:', urcInfo.isValid); console.log('Referrer:', urcInfo.referrerMain.toString()); console.log('Usage count:', urcInfo.usageCount); // Get system configuration const systemConfig = await getSystemConfig({ rpc: 'https://api.devnet.solana.com' }); console.log('System manager:', systemConfig.systemManagerAccount.toString()); console.log('Protocol fee rate:', systemConfig.graduateFeeRate); } ### TypeScript Usage ```typescript import { launchToken, mintToken, setUrc, getMintData, getUrcData, getSystemConfig, generateMetadataUri, validateImageFile, LaunchTokenOptions, LaunchTokenResponse, MintTokenOptions, MintTokenResponse, SetUrcOptions, SetUrcResponse, GetMintDataOptions, GetMintDataResponse, GetUrcDataOptions, GetUrcDataResponse, SystemConfigAccountOptions, SystemConfigAccountData, GenerateMetadataUriOptions, MetadataUploadResponse } from '@flipflop-sdk/node'; const mintResult: MintTokenResponse = await mintToken(mintOptions); } ``` ## API Reference ### Core Functions #### `generateMetadataUri(options: GenerateMetadataUriOptions): Promise<MetadataUploadResponse>` **NEW** - Generate metadata URI by uploading image and metadata to Irys network. **Parameters:** ```typescript interface GenerateMetadataUriOptions { rpc: string; // RPC endpoint URL name: string; // Token name symbol: string; // Token symbol description?: string; // Token description (optional) imagePath: string; // Path to image file } ``` **Returns:** ```typescript interface MetadataUploadResponse { success: boolean; metadataUrl?: string; // Irys gateway URL for metadata JSON imageUrl?: string; // Irys gateway URL for uploaded image error?: string; // Error message if upload failed } ``` **Image Requirements:** - **Supported formats**: JPEG, PNG, GIF, WebP, AVIF - **Maximum size**: 250KB - **File validation**: Automatic type and size checking **Example:** ```javascript const result = await generateMetadataUri({ rpc: 'https://api.devnet.solana.com', name: 'My Awesome Token', symbol: 'MAT', description: 'This is an awesome token for the community', imagePath: './assets/token-logo.png' }); if (result.success) { console.log('Metadata URL:', result.metadataUrl); console.log('Image URL:', result.imageUrl); } else { console.error('Upload failed:', result.error); } ``` #### `validateImageFile(imagePath: string): { valid: boolean; error?: string }` **NEW** - Validate image file before upload. **Parameters:** - `imagePath`: Path to the image file **Returns:** - `valid`: Boolean indicating if file is valid - `error`: Error message if validation fails **Example:** ```javascript const validation = validateImageFile('./logo.png'); if (!validation.valid) { console.error('Image validation failed:', validation.error); } ``` #### `launchToken(options: LaunchTokenOptions): Promise<LaunchTokenResponse>` Launch a new token with specified parameters. **Parameters:** ```typescript interface LaunchTokenOptions { rpc: string; // RPC endpoint URL name: string; // Token name symbol: string; // Token symbol tokenType: string; // 'meme' or 'standard' uri?: string; // Metadata URI (optional, use generateMetadataUri) keypairBs58?: string; // Base58 encoded private key keypairFile?: string; // Path to keypair file } ``` **Returns:** ```typescript interface LaunchTokenResponse { success: boolean; transactionHash: string; mintAddress: PublicKey; configAddress: PublicKey; metadata: TokenMetadata; configuration: ConfigAccountData; } ``` **Example:** ```javascript const result = await launchToken({ rpc: 'https://api.devnet.solana.com', name: 'My Token', symbol: 'MTK', tokenType: 'meme', uri: 'https://gateway.irys.xyz/your-metadata-id', // From generateMetadataUri keypairBs58: 'your-base58-private-key' }); ``` #### `setUrc(options: SetUrcOptions): Promise<SetUrcResponse>` Set Universal Referral Code for a token. **Parameters:** ```typescript interface SetUrcOptions { rpc: string; // RPC endpoint URL urc: string; // Universal Referral Code mint: string; // Token mint address keypairBs58?: string; // Base58 encoded private key keypairFile?: string; // Path to keypair file } ``` **Returns:** ```typescript interface SetUrcResponse { transactionHash: string; urc: string; mint: PublicKey; referrer: PublicKey; referrerTokenAccount: PublicKey; codeHash: PublicKey; usageCount: number; activatedAt: number; } ``` **Example:** ```javascript const result = await setUrc({ rpc: 'https://api.devnet.solana.com', mint: 'TokenMintAddress', urc: 'UNIQUECODE', keypairBs58: 'your-base58-private-key' }); ``` #### `mintToken(options: MintTokenOptions): Promise<MintTokenResponse>` Mint tokens using a URC code. **Parameters:** ```typescript interface MintTokenOptions { rpc: string; // RPC endpoint URL mint: string; // Token mint address urc: string; // Universal Referral Code keypairBs58?: string; // Base58 encoded private key keypairFile?: string; // Path to keypair file } ``` **Returns:** ```typescript interface MintTokenResponse { success: boolean; message?: string; data?: { tx: string; owner: PublicKey; tokenAccount: PublicKey; } } ``` **Example:** ```javascript const result = await mintToken({ rpc: 'https://api.devnet.solana.com', mint: 'TokenMintAddress', urc: 'UNIQUECODE', keypairBs58: 'minter-base58-private-key' }); ``` #### `getMintData(options: GetMintDataOptions): Promise<GetMintDataResponse>` Get detailed information about a token. **Parameters:** ```typescript interface GetMintDataOptions { rpc: string; // RPC endpoint URL mint: string; // Token mint address } ``` **Returns:** ```typescript interface GetMintDataResponse { mint: PublicKey; name: string; symbol: string; uri: string; isMutable: boolean; configAccount: PublicKey; admin: PublicKey; tokenVault: PublicKey; feeRate: number; targetEras: number; initialMintSize: number; epochesPerEra: number; targetSecondsPerEpoch: number; reduceRatio: number; maxSupply: number; liquidityTokensRatio: number; currentSupply: number; liquidityTokensSupply: number; minterTokensSupply: number; } ``` **Example:** ```javascript const info = await getMintData({ rpc: 'https://api.devnet.solana.com', mint: 'TokenMintAddress' }); ``` #### `getUrcData(options: GetUrcDataOptions): Promise<GetUrcDataResponse>` Get information about a URC code. **Parameters:** ```typescript interface GetUrcDataOptions { rpc: string; // RPC endpoint URL urc: string; // Universal Referral Code } ``` **Returns:** ```typescript interface GetUrcDataResponse { urc: string; codeHash: PublicKey; mint: PublicKey; referrerMain: PublicKey; referrerAta: PublicKey; usageCount: number; activeTimestamp: number; isValid: boolean; } ``` **Example:** ```javascript const info = await getUrcData({ rpc: 'https://api.devnet.solana.com', urc: 'UNIQUECODE' }); ``` #### `getSystemConfig(options: SystemConfigAccountOptions): Promise<SystemConfigAccountData>` Get system configuration information. **Parameters:** ```typescript interface SystemConfigAccountOptions { rpc: string; // RPC endpoint URL } ``` **Returns:** ```typescript interface SystemConfigAccountData { systemConfigAccount: PublicKey; systemManagerAccount: PublicKey; admin: PublicKey; count: number; referralUsageMaxCount: number; protocolFeeAccount: PublicKey; refundFeeRate: number; referrerResetIntervalSeconds: number; updateMetadataFee: number; customizedDeployFee: number; initPoolWsolAmount: number; graduateFeeRate: number; minGraduateFee: number; raydiumCpmmCreateFee: number; } ``` **Example:** ```javascript const config = await getSystemConfig({ rpc: 'https://api.devnet.solana.com' }); ``` ### Utility Functions All utility functions and constants can also be imported from the library: ```typescript import { initProvider, initProviderNoSigner, loadKeypairFromBase58, loadKeypairFromFile, validateImageFile, CONFIGS, NetworkType } from '@flipflop-sdk/node'; ``` ## Configuration ### Network Types - `mainnet`: Production network - `devnet`: Development network - `local`: Local validator ### Token Types - `meme`: Aggressive parameters for community tokens - `standard`: Conservative parameters for utility tokens ### RPC Endpoints - **Mainnet**: `https://api.mainnet-beta.solana.com` - **Devnet**: `https://api.devnet.solana.com` - **Local**: `http://127.0.0.1:8899` ### Irys Network Integration - **Devnet**: `https://api-dev.flipflop.plus/api/irys/upload` - **Mainnet**: `https://api.flipflop.plus/api/irys/upload` - **Gateway**: `https://gateway.irys.xyz/` ## Authentication The SDK supports two methods for providing keypairs: ### 1. Base58 Encoded Private Key ```javascript const result = await launchToken({ // ... other options keypairBs58: 'your-base58-encoded-private-key' }); ``` ### 2. Keypair File Path ```javascript const result = await launchToken({ // ... other options keypairFile: './path/to/keypair.json' }); ``` ## Error Handling All functions throw descriptive errors for validation and runtime issues: ```javascript try { // Validate image first const validation = validateImageFile('./logo.png'); if (!validation.valid) { throw new Error(`Image validation failed: ${validation.error}`); } // Generate metadata const metadataResult = await generateMetadataUri({ rpc: 'https://api.devnet.solana.com', name: 'My Token', symbol: 'MTK', description: 'My awesome token', imagePath: './logo.png' }); if (!metadataResult.success) { throw new Error(`Metadata upload failed: ${metadataResult.error}`); } // Launch token const result = await launchToken({ rpc: 'https://api.devnet.solana.com', name: 'My Token', symbol: 'MTK', tokenType: 'meme', uri: metadataResult.metadataUrl, keypairBs58: 'invalid-key' }); } catch (error) { console.error('Operation failed:', error.message); } ``` ## Development ### Dependencies The SDK uses the following key dependencies: **Core Solana Libraries:** - `@coral-xyz/anchor` (0.31.1) - Anchor framework for Solana - `@solana/web3.js` (^1.98.0) - Solana Web3 JavaScript API - `@solana/spl-token` (^0.4.9) - SPL Token library - `@solana/spl-token-metadata` (^0.1.6) - Token metadata standard **Utility Libraries:** - `axios` (^1.11.0) - HTTP client for API requests - `form-data` (^4.0.4) - Multipart form data for file uploads - `bn.js` (5.2.1) - Big number arithmetic - `bs58` (^6.0.0) - Base58 encoding/decoding - `decimal.js` (^10.4.3) - Decimal arithmetic - `sleep-promise` (^9.1.0) - Promise-based sleep utility ### Building ```bash # Install dependencies npm install # Build the library npm run build # Run tests npm test # Watch mode for development npm run dev ``` ### Testing ```bash # Run all tests npm test # Run specific test file npm test launch.test.ts # Run tests with coverage npm run test:coverage # Run metadata tests (requires network connection) npm test metadata.test.ts ``` **Note**: Metadata tests make real API calls to devnet and require internet connection. ## Examples ### Complete Token Launch Flow with Metadata ```javascript const { generateMetadataUri, launchToken, setUrc, mintToken } = require('@flipflop-sdk/node'); async function completeFlowWithMetadata() { const rpc = 'https://api.devnet.solana.com'; const creatorKey = 'creator-base58-private-key'; const minterKey = 'minter-base58-private-key'; // 1. Generate metadata URI console.log('Step 1: Generating metadata...'); const metadata = await generateMetadataUri({ rpc, name: 'Demo Token', symbol: 'DEMO', description: 'A demonstration token with custom metadata', imagePath: './assets/demo-logo.png' }); if (!metadata.success) { throw new Error(`Metadata generation failed: ${metadata.error}`); } console.log('Metadata URL:', metadata.metadataUrl); console.log('Image URL:', metadata.imageUrl); // 2. Launch token with metadata console.log('Step 2: Launching token...'); const launch = await launchToken({ rpc, name: 'Demo Token', symbol: 'DEMO', tokenType: 'standard', uri: metadata.metadataUrl, keypairBs58: creatorKey }); console.log('Token launched:', launch.mintAddress.toString()); // 3. Set URC console.log('Step 3: Setting URC...'); const urc = await setUrc({ rpc, mint: launch.mintAddress.toString(), urc: 'DEMO_CODE', keypairBs58: creatorKey }); console.log('URC set:', urc.urc); // 4. Mint tokens console.log('Step 4: Minting tokens...'); const mint = await mintToken({ rpc, mint: launch.mintAddress.toString(), urc: 'DEMO_CODE', keypairBs58: minterKey }); console.log('Mint successful:', mint.success); return { metadata: metadata.metadataUrl, mint: launch.mintAddress.toString(), urc: urc.urc, transaction: mint.data?.tx }; } ``` ### Batch Operations with Metadata Validation ```javascript async function batchMintWithValidation() { const imagePaths = [ './assets/logo1.png', './assets/logo2.jpg', './assets/logo3.gif' ]; // Validate all images first const validations = imagePaths.map(path => ({ path, validation: validateImageFile(path) })); const validImages = validations.filter(v => v.validation.valid); const invalidImages = validations.filter(v => !v.validation.valid); if (invalidImages.length > 0) { console.warn('Invalid images found:'); invalidImages.forEach(img => { console.warn(`- ${img.path}: ${img.validation.error}`); }); } // Process valid images const metadataPromises = validImages.map((img, index) => generateMetadataUri({ rpc: 'https://api.devnet.solana.com', name: `Batch Token ${index + 1}`, symbol: `BT${index + 1}`, description: `Batch generated token ${index + 1}`, imagePath: img.path }) ); const metadataResults = await Promise.all(metadataPromises); console.log('Batch metadata generation results:', metadataResults); return metadataResults; } ``` ## Migration from CLI ### CLI to SDK Mapping | CLI Command | SDK Function | |-------------|-------------| | `flipflop launch` | `launchToken()` | | `flipflop set-urc` | `setUrc()` | | `flipflop mint` | `mintToken()` | | `flipflop display-mint` | `getMintData()` | | `flipflop display-urc` | `getUrcData()` | | **NEW** | `generateMetadataUri()` | | **NEW** | `validateImageFile()` | ### Migration Example **CLI usage:** ```bash flipflop launch --name "MyToken" --symbol "MTK" --keypair-file ./keypair.json --rpc https://api.devnet.solana.com ``` **SDK usage:** ```javascript const { generateMetadataUri, launchToken } = require('@flipflop-sdk/node'); // Generate metadata first (new capability) const metadata = await generateMetadataUri({ rpc: 'https://api.devnet.solana.com', name: 'MyToken', symbol: 'MTK', description: 'My awesome token', imagePath: './logo.png' }); // Launch with metadata const result = await launchToken({ name: 'MyToken', symbol: 'MTK', tokenType: 'standard', uri: metadata.metadataUrl, rpc: 'https://api.devnet.solana.com', keypairFile: './keypair.json' }); ``` ## Security - Never commit private keys to version control - Use environment variables for sensitive configuration - Validate all inputs before SDK operations - **Image Security**: Only upload trusted images, validate file types and sizes - **Metadata Security**: Review generated metadata before using in production - Consider using `Keypair.fromSeed()` for deterministic key generation - Always verify transaction results before proceeding - **Network Security**: Use HTTPS endpoints for all API calls ## TypeScript Support Full TypeScript support with comprehensive type definitions: ```typescript import { LaunchTokenOptions, LaunchTokenResponse, MintTokenOptions, MintTokenResponse, SetUrcOptions, SetUrcResponse, GetMintDataOptions, GetMintDataResponse, GetUrcDataOptions, GetUrcDataResponse, SystemConfigAccountOptions, SystemConfigAccountData, GenerateMetadataUriOptions, MetadataUploadResponse, MetadataParams, TokenMetadata, ConfigAccountData, NetworkType } from '@flipflop-sdk/node'; ``` ## Contributing 1.
